In the midst of the Alpine Lakes Wilderness and the Glacier Peaks Wilderness areas, hiking in the Wenatchee National Forest offers some of the most scenic and challenging terrain in the Pacific Northwest.
With over 2,500 miles of recreational trails, hikers of all ages can find a place to enjoy the beauty of this area. Leavenworth Ranger Station have maps of all the trails in the areas as well as day use permits for those areas that require them.
